Sanders County Fair
Each year 4-H members are given the opportunity to show case the knowledge and skills they have gained throughout the year. Sharing a project at the fair gives them the chance to show what they have learned.
4-H members participation in the Sanders County Fair helps youth develop essential life skills such as:
- Leadership
- Organization
- Thinking Critically
- Setting Goals
- Time Management
- Communication
Fair Registration
Registering 4-H projects for the Sanders County Fair is done through FairEntry. It is very important to pay close attention to the open and close dates for registering which projects will be exhibited at the fair.
When members are ready to register their projects for the fair they will want to log in to fairentry.com. If you are needing help with registering this short video has alot of helpful information: https://vimeo.com/209918998.
